About MARYSVILLE PUBLIC LIBRARY
The Marysville Public Library provides quality information resources and services to educate, entertain, enrich and strengthen our diverse community.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Columbus?

Understanding the cost of living near Columbus is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Marysville Public Library.
Columbus' Cost of Living Index is approximately 86.8 (13.2% less expensive than US average; 4.4% less than OH average). State capital (Ohio State Univ.), growing, affordable. COTA bus.
